浏览网页时,有时难以直接找到视频链接。查阅网页源码却是个不错的解决方法。为此,我们需要掌握一些源码结构的基础知识,比如不同标签的含义,以及如何在代码中找到视频链接的相关信息。
了解网页源代码结构
大多数网页的源代码中包含了众多信息。我们需要了解HTML标签的功能。比如,标签是页面的根基。众多元素都包含在内,就像一棵树,我们需要逐层分析。视频的链接可能分布在不同的标签中,比如
标签中存放着网页的基础设置,尽管视频链接一般不在其中,但这一部分对于掌握网页架构极为关键。浏览器工具使用
大多数现代浏览器都配备了开发者辅助功能。以为例,通过按下F12键,我们就能激活这些工具。这些工具极大地便利了源代码的搜索。在界面左侧,我们可以浏览网页的组成元素,迅速找到视频相关的标签。浏览器同样具备类似的开发者工具,尽管操作界面略有差异,但功能上并无二致。
一旦发现含有视频链接的成分,开发者工具便允许我们直接查阅相关源码。这样一来,我们便无需在网页源码的茫茫大海中盲目搜寻。
不同视频平台差异
优酷和爱奇艺等大型视频网站,网页设计较为复杂,还拥有独特的加密技术。想要找到视频的具体地址,可能并非易事。这是因为这些视频都受到版权保护,通常是通过它们自有的播放系统进行播放。
然而,那些规模较小、主要依赖用户上传视频的网站,操作上可能更为简便。它们可能采用开源的视频播放器,比如Video.js,视频地址在源代码中通常较为容易定位。尽管也有加密的情况,但与大型商业平台相比,寻找起来还是要简单一些。
从脚本代码寻找
网页源码中,某些网站会采用脚本实现视频链接的动态引入。此时,我们需要关注脚本中的函数调用及变量设定。例如,存在一个专用于启动视频播放的函数,其中可能包含与视频链接相关的参数传输。
这些脚本代码可能经过压缩或混淆处理,因此我们得具备一定的解读脚本的能力。比如,有些变量会被简化命名,我们得根据上下文来推断它们可能代表的意思,这样才能找到与视频地址相关的部分。
检查网络请求
网页加载视频时,会向网络发送请求。此时,我们可进入浏览器开发者工具的网络标签页,查看这些请求。在过滤设置中,我们可以选择仅显示与视频相关的请求。
视频通常分段加载,这就导致可能需要发起多次请求。在这些请求中,实际的视频链接可能隐藏在某个较大的请求里。它可能以.mp4或.m3u8格式结尾,我们需要仔细查找并加以识别。
可能遇到的问题
有时,源代码里的地址并非真正的视频来源,它可能只是个中间节点或是经过加密的地址。即便我们找到了所谓的“视频地址”,也可能无法直接观看视频。
若对网页结构不甚了解,在源代码中随意翻找,极易迷失方向。面对庞大而复杂的网页源代码,即便投入大量时间,也可能难以找到所需的有效链接。
你是否曾遭遇过难以搜寻视频链接的网页?欢迎在评论区分享你的经历,并对本文点赞和转发。